About the Role:
As a CBRE Compensation Sr. Consultant, you will provide advice, direction, and guidance on specifically defined compensation matters.
This job is a part of the Total Rewards functional area which focuses on planning, designing, evaluating, and administering employee compensation and benefits programs.

What You’ll Do:
  • Serve as a point of escalation for complex compensation issues.
  • Plan, execute, and oversee large compensation team projects.
  • Facilitate assigned salary surveys to understand compensation levels in the organization.
  • Complete job evaluation studies and ensure that job descriptions on file are current, complete, and accurate.
  • Oversee executive compensation planning, executive communications, supplemental LTD, and Deferred Compensation steps.
  • Verify that organizational compensation programs are consistently administered in compliance with company policies and government regulations.
  • Apply advanced knowledge to seek and develop new, better methods for accomplishing both individual and department objectives.
  • Showcase expertise in own job discipline and in-depth knowledge of other job disciplines within the organization function.
  • Coach others to develop in-depth knowledge and expertise in most or all areas within the function.
  • Lead by example and model behaviors that are consistent with CBRE RISE values. Anticipates potential objections and persuades others, often at senior levels and of divergent interest, to adopt a different point of view.
  • Impact the achievement of customer, operational, project, or service objectives across multi-discipline teams. Work is guided by functional policies which impact the design of procedures and policies.
  • Contribute to new products, processes, standards, and/or operational plans in support of achieving functional goals.
  • Communicate difficult and complex ideas with the ability to influence.
